"We (family of 3) stayed over one night after a day at Hershey Park. This is a great clean and very affordable stay for the amenities included (indoor swimming pool, free breakfast, 10 mins away from Hershey Park).
The breakfast area though quite sufficient, was very small for the number of guests ( there was a line for waffles, seating area a bit dense).
The restaurant was closed when we got there on a Monday at 5pm and they didn’t offer any viable suggestions (we did Uber Eats which was a bad experience-no fault of the hotel).
Overall I would definitely go back!"

"Overall, our stay was good, and the staff members we interacted with were helpful and kind. The hotel is also a convenient, short drive from Hersheypark.
Some of the amenities were outdated, particularly the gym, although I still appreciated having one available. I also appreciated the water cooler, cookies, and tea bar in the lobby.
However, I was concerned about the large cooler of alcohol bottles in the lobby. There were times when it appeared to be unattended. Some guests who were clearly intoxicated brought bottles from the lobby into the hot tub area, which created a safety concern.
I also had an upsetting experience with a couple at the pool who said they were regular guests. They were drinking heavily, and the wife made blatantly racist remarks to me, apparently not realizing that I am in an interracial relationship. I later learned that they had previously been flagged for making inappropriate comments at the pool. If the hotel is already aware of this pattern of behavior, I hope it will take stronger steps to protect other guests.
I’m glad we used the pool on our first day because it was out of order by the second day, which was disappointing. We also found a ball underneath our bed, suggesting that the room had not been cleaned as thoroughly as it should have been.
There were definitely positive aspects to our stay, but the cleanliness issue, alcohol-related safety concerns, and handling of repeat guests with known inappropriate behavior need attention."
